Setting a value When setting a value, the button is used to activate the set option. The and
buttons are used to change the options that can be set, such as on or off. If the
set option involves setting a number, for example a alarm limit, the button is
used to increase a digit, and the button is used to decrease a digit. The
button is used to toggle between digits.The option/digit that is active for setting is
marked with a underscore. When the underscore on the last option has dissa-
peared, the setting has been performed.
4.1.1 Setting Date
To set the date, perform the following steps:
1. Choose the Settings icon in the main menu, press .
2. Choose “Clock”, press .
3. The display will now show the date.
4. Set the date.
